> test-container-executor.c doesn't work:
> * It assumes that realpath(/bin/ls) will be /bin/ls, whereas it is actually
> /usr/bin/ls on many systems.
> * The recursive delete logic in container-executor.c fails -- nftw does the
> wrong thing when confronted with directories with the wrong mode (permission
> bits), leading to an attempt to run rmdir on a non-empty directory.
